Thrilling Draw in Ibagué: Tolima and América Share Points
Ibagué, Colombia – In a hard-fought match at the Estadio Manuel Murillo Toro, Deportes Tolima and América de Cali drew 1-1 in a match corresponding to matchday 3 of the Apertura Quadrangular of Primera A. The match, refereed by Alejandro Moncada Sanchez, was characterized by its intensity and numerous cautions.
Deportes Tolima took the lead early in the 16th minute with a goal by Andrés Castro, assisted by Kevin Pérez. However, the lead would not last. América de Cali, with greater ball possession (58% against 42%), relentlessly sought the equalizer. The *Escarlata’s* pressure finally paid off in the 72nd minute, when David Vergara converted a penalty to level the score.
The match was tense, with a total of seven yellow cards shown: four for Tolima and three for América. Despite the efforts of both teams to break the tie, the draw persisted until the final whistle. América dominated possession and created more goal-scoring opportunities, with 12 shots in total (6 on target) compared to Tolima’s 7 (1 on target). Nevertheless, Tolima’s effectiveness in their only shot on target proved crucial to obtain a point at home. The match left a bittersweet taste for both teams, who continue to fight for a place in the tournament final.
